图书介绍

C语言程序设计PDF|Epub|txt|kindle电子书版本网盘下载

C语言程序设计
  • 彭正文,徐新爱主编 著
  • 出版社: 大连:大连理工大学出版社
  • ISBN:9787561150566
  • 出版时间:2009
  • 标注页数:220页
  • 文件大小:71MB
  • 文件页数:230页
  • 主题词:C语言-程序设计-高等学校-教材

PDF下载


点此进入-本书在线PDF格式电子书下载【推荐-云解压-方便快捷】直接下载PDF格式图书。移动端-PC端通用
种子下载[BT下载速度快]温馨提示:(请使用BT下载软件FDM进行下载)软件下载地址页直链下载[便捷但速度慢]  [在线试读本书]   [在线获取解压码]

下载说明

C语言程序设计PDF格式电子书版下载

下载的文件为RAR压缩包。需要使用解压软件进行解压得到PDF格式图书。

建议使用BT下载工具Free Download Manager进行下载,简称FDM(免费,没有广告,支持多平台)。本站资源全部打包为BT种子。所以需要使用专业的BT下载软件进行下载。如BitComet qBittorrent uTorrent等BT下载工具。迅雷目前由于本站不是热门资源。不推荐使用!后期资源热门了。安装了迅雷也可以迅雷进行下载!

(文件页数 要大于 标注页数,上中下等多册电子书除外)

注意:本站所有压缩包均有解压码: 点击下载压缩包解压工具

图书目录

第1章 概述1

1.1 程序设计的基本概念1

1.1.1 计算机和程序1

1.1.2 算法和数据结构3

1.2 程序设计语言7

1.3 程序设计基本步骤9

1.4 C语言概述9

1.4.1 C语言的历史及发展9

1.4.2 C语言的特点10

1.5 C编译环境11

习题13

第2章 简单的C语言源程序14

2.1 几个C语言源程序14

2.1.1 输出一行字符14

2.1.2 输入一个数并输出15

2.1.3 求两个数的和16

2.2 初步剖析C语言源程序17

2.3 从C语言源程序到可执行程序的过程19

习题25

第3章 C语言源程序的基本元素27

3.1 标识符和保留字27

3.2 常量和变量28

3.2.1 常量28

3.2.2 变量28

3.3 基本数据类型29

3.3.1 类型及存储29

3.3.2 类型转换32

3.4 运算符和表达式33

3.4.1 算术运算符和算术表达式34

3.4.2 关系运算符和关系表达式36

3.4.3 逻辑运算符和逻辑表达式37

3.4.4 位运算符38

3.4.5 赋值运算符和赋值表达式38

3.4.6 其他运算符39

3.4.7 优先级和结合性40

3.5 C语言源程序构成41

3.5.1 C语言语句41

3.5.2 函数定义格式及其调用格式42

3.5.3 基于控制台的输入输出43

习题47

第4章 基本流程结构51

4.1 顺序结构51

4.2 分支结构53

4.2.1 if语句实现分支54

4.2.2 switch语句实现分支60

4.3 循环结构63

4.3.1 for循环64

4.3.2 while循环68

4.3.3 do-while循环69

4.3.4 几种循环语句的比较70

4.3.5 循环嵌套73

4.3.6 break和continue的使用78

习题81

第5章 数组90

5.1 一维数组90

5.1.1 一维数组定义90

5.1.2 一维数组的应用91

5.2 二维数组93

5.2.1 二维数组定义93

5.2.2 二维数组的应用94

习题98

第6章 函数99

6.1 函数定义与声明99

6.2 变量及参数传递101

6.2.1 局部变量与全局变量101

6.2.2 变量的存储类型103

6.2.3 参数传递108

6.3 函数的嵌套调用111

6.4 递归函数112

习题115

第7章 指针类型及构造类型117

7.1 指针类型117

7.1.1 指针相关概念117

7.1.2 动态分配空间和释放空间119

7.1.3 指针运算121

7.2 指针与数组的关系124

7.2.1 指针与一维数组124

7.2.2 一维字符数组与字符串126

7.2.3 指针与二维数组128

7.3 函数指针131

7.3.1 创建指向函数的指针变量131

7.3.2 使用函数指针132

7.4 指针参数135

7.5 结构类型138

7.5.1 结构类型的定义和使用138

7.5.2 结构数组141

7.5.3 结构链表145

7.6 枚举类型148

7.7 共用体类型153

7.8 类型定义typedef157

习题158

第8章 文件159

8.1 文件及文件结构159

8.2 文件的基本操作160

8.2.1 文件的打开和关闭161

8.2.2 文件的读写163

8.2.3 文件读写指针的定位172

习题174

第9章 预处理命令176

9.1 概述176

9.2 宏定义176

9.2.1 常量宏定义177

9.2.2 带参宏定义178

9.2.3 函数与带参宏180

9.3 文件包含命令181

9.4 条件编译182

9.5 其他预处理命令184

习题187

第10章 窗口编程简介188

10.1 Windows系统及程序简介188

10.1.1 Windows介绍188

10.1.2 用户界面的构件189

10.1.3 面向对象的思维方法190

10.1.4 句柄191

10.1.5 数据类型及常量192

10.1.6 应用程序使用的一些术语195

10.1.7 事件和消息197

10.1.8 窗口对象198

10.2 一个最简单的Win32程序203

10.3 窗口类及注册208

10.4 窗口的显示209

10.5 消息循环210

习题212

附录213

附录一 ASCII代码对照表213

附录二 C语言的保留字214

附录三 常见的C语言库函数214

参考文献220

热门推荐